Product overview

The Harvard Apparatus ECM 2001+, Hybridoma Production System is a high-performance electroporation device designed for hybridoma cell fusion and monoclonal antibody production. It features precise control over electroporation parameters and includes coaxial chambers with identical electrical properties, enabling seamless scale-up from optimisation to production. A transparent-bottom optimisation chamber allows visual monitoring of cell alignment under an inverted or standard microscope, making it ideal for immunology and biotechnology applications.

Scope of Supply:

  • ECM® 2001+ Generator
  • Coaxial optimisation chamber (2 ml)
  • Coaxial production chamber (9 ml)
  • Adapter set
  • Cytofusion medium C (500 ml)
